WebMar 13, 2015 · They are not, in fact, decomposable. Solo cups are made with a type of plastic called polystyrene, also known as PS or by the recycling number 6. Plenty of other things are made with #6 plastic, including toys, food containers and jewel cases. Styrofoam is a form of #6 plastic called expanded polystyrene (or EPS). The labeled red bags must be … mistar student portal southgateWebPolypropylene is recyclable through some curbside recycling programs, but only about 3% of PP products are currently being recycled in the US. Recycled PP is used to make landscaping border stripping, battery cases, brooms, bins and trays. However, #5 plastic is today becoming more accepted by recyclers. PP is considered safe for reuse. mistar southgate schoolsWebPurpose.
